Ranch Fence Replacement in Roseville, CA
Ranch fence replacement services involve removing and installing fences that define property boundaries, enclosures for livestock, or decorative barriers around rural and suburban properties. These projects typically include replacing aging or damaged fencing materials such as wood, wire, or vinyl, to improve privacy, security, or aesthetic appeal. Property owners often seek these services when fences have become worn, broken, or no longer meet their needs for containment or boundary marking. Understanding the types of fencing materials available, the scope of the replacement, and any local regulations or property considerations can help homeowners plan for a successful upgrade.
Before requesting ranch fence replacement, property owners should assess the current condition of their existing fence and determine whether a full replacement or repair is needed. It’s important to consider the purpose of the fence, whether for livestock containment, privacy, or decorative purposes, as this influences the choice of materials and design. Additionally, understanding property boundaries and any relevant zoning or land use restrictions can ensure the new fence complies with local guidelines. Proper planning helps ensure the new fencing meets functional needs while enhancing the property's overall appearance.

Ranch Fence Replacement Questions
What types of fences are suitable for replacement? Common options include wood, vinyl, and chain-link fences, depending on the property's needs and style preferences.
When should a fence be replaced instead of repaired? Replacement is recommended when the fence is extensively damaged, rotted, or no longer provides adequate privacy or security.
What should property owners consider before replacing a fence? Factors include the desired material, local regulations, property boundaries, and the purpose of the fence.
How does the replacement process typically work? It involves removing the existing fence, preparing the site, and installing the new fencing material securely.
